R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Accurately measure the dimensions and determine installation processes for windows and doors
- Provide installation solutions that match customer expectations, adapts production specifications to the installation requirements, utilizing a thorough knowledge of Renewal Products
- Confirms details within the sales contract to assure customer expectations are in alignment with product features and options and installation process
- Provides feedback to sales representatives when a job goes on hold, works with reps to resolve questions in a quick and efficient manner.
- Determines installation labor duration and installation materials needed to successfully complete the job.
- Completes and submits required job files that are complete, correct and timely providing a quality hand off to internal customers
- Communicates with Installation crew on specifics for the jobs, providing advanced notice of unique factors the crew will need to be aware of with the job.
- Approves any additional installation labor required to complete the job
- Trouble shoots issues with installation crew on day of installation; this may include onsite support to the job.
- Work directly with Homeowners to resolve installation process issues.
- Provide support to sales reps with pre-sale site visits to define project scope and ensure the scope of work is reflected in pricing and contract documents.
- Supports installation leadership on recruitment of installation sub-contractors
